Production Workers Pension Fund's Production Workers Pension Fund reported $6M in total assets and N/A participants in its 2024 DOL Form 5500 filing, ranking in the 45th percentile by assets among filed plans. Figures are as reported by the plan sponsor to the Department of Labor, not audited or endorsed by PlainRetire.

Frequently Asked Questions

How did Production Workers Pension Fund assets move in 2024?
Production Workers Pension Fund declined sharply - down 27.0% during 2024, from $8M to $6M. Reported net income was -$2M.
How have Production Workers Pension Fund plan assets changed over time?
Across 3 plan years on file (2022-2024), Production Workers Pension Fund's sponsor-wide assets declined 39.3%, from $10M to $6M.
